Popular places to visit

Schlossplatz
Framed by historical buildings, scattered with monuments and home to open-air concerts, this central square is one of the city’s favorite social gathering places.

Konigstrasse
Browse the vast range of jewelry and visit the museums on one of the longest and most popular shopping boulevards in Germany.

Schillerplatz
Tour a 16th-century public square and visit its renovated ancient structures including a castle, church and a gothic building.

Neues Schloss
Admire the Baroque architecture of this 18th-century royal palace, peek inside its opulent rooms and then relax on the grassy lawns of its garden square.

Old Castle
Visit an ancient castle to learn about the history of the region. See Stone Age relics, crown jewels of nobility and part of a Roman soldier’s ceremonial uniform.

Market Hall
Stock up on local specialties and foods from around the world amid the art nouveau surrounds of this huge indoor market.
